New Jersey's voter fraud cases prove the SAVE America Act is urgently needed

Source: M.D. Kittle. "Blue State Makes The Case For The SAVE America Act." May 5, 2026. thefederalist.com

The Gist

The author argues that recent voter fraud cases in New Jersey prove we need stricter voting laws. Since New Jersey doesn't verify citizenship and relies on people being honest, illegal voting is happening and we need the SAVE America Act to fix this.

Conclusion

The SAVE America Act should be passed immediately to prevent noncitizen voting fraud

Premises

  1. New Jersey has documented cases of noncitizens illegally voting in federal elections between 2020-2024
  2. New Jersey's election system relies on an 'honor system' with no verification of citizenship status
  3. New Jersey admits it does not check voter rolls for citizenship, deaths, moves, or prison status
  4. A former mayoral candidate attempted to submit approximately 1,000 fraudulent voter registration applications
  5. Current federal law lacks requirements for documentary proof of citizenship to register or photo ID to vote
  6. Senate Republicans are stalling the SAVE America Act despite majority American support for election integrity measures
